Ticket: ORM-2291. The nightly build of the Larkspur data layer refactor failed its signature check during artifact promotion. Investigation shows the migration bundle was re-signed by the staging pipeline after the canonical build, producing a mismatch against the manifest. On-call: please re-run promotion from the original artifact, not the staging copy, and verify against the team's current signing key, shown here.

rollout seal: bky4_x7Gc

# Handover: Shelfwright Catalogue Import

Hi Tomas — handing over the Shelfwright import pipeline before I rotate off. Plugin authors should know the importer normalises MARC-ish records into our internal schema before any plugin hooks fire, so don't assume raw input fields survive. Retries are exponential with a hard cap of five attempts, and malformed batches are quarantined rather than dropped. Hooks run in registration order, synchronously. Everything is driven from a single config document, reproduced in full below.

deployment values, tafog-kagap:
wenath:
  pin: 4244
  metrics_host: metrics.wenath.lumicsys.internal
  tenant: istix
  seal: seal_10585894

Subject: Quickstore 4.2 — bloom filter now fronts the KV layer

Plugin authors: starting with this release, Quickstore places a bloom filter ahead of the key-value store. Negative lookups return faster; false positives fall through safely. No API changes are required on your side. Verify your plugin against the staging build referenced below.

session token of fahif-tadup = htk3_9c7

Ticket: Expired creds blocking SDK parity check — Brimhall Mobile

Hey, quick one for review. We're verifying feature parity between the Lorquin Swift SDK and the Lorquin Kotlin SDK before the Fennmark release, but the service account both test harnesses use expired over the weekend. Parity suite is stuck at the auth step, so we can't compare the offline-sync behavior. Ops minted a replacement this morning and asked me to attach it here for your sign-off.

service key, fawip-bajef: kto11_Qt5wZK9vdNC

## Account Recovery — QueueTide Autoscaler

If the autoscaler's service account is locked after failed token refreshes, reviewers approving the recovery PR must verify the queue-depth metrics exporter is paused first. Then run the unlock script from the ops bastion. When the script prompts for operator verification, supply the recovery passphrase shown below.

recovery phrase for fajeg-hagug: holox-fenmir